AI时代DNS的体系化韧性构建:从基础解析到智能调度

一、AI时代DNS的范式重构:从基础服务到智能中枢

在第四届下一代域名系统发展论坛上,中国工程院院士指出:”AI交互产生的DNS查询量已呈现指数级增长,传统架构难以支撑万物互联时代的动态需求。”这一论断揭示了DNS系统正在经历根本性变革。

传统DNS的三大核心功能(域名解析、负载均衡、容灾备份)已无法满足AI场景需求。以智能驾驶场景为例,车辆每秒需处理200+次DNS查询,既要实现车联网设备快速认证,又要确保低时延的路径选择。这种复合型需求推动DNS向六大新能力域演进:

  1. 服务发现层:通过SRV记录扩展实现微服务实例的动态注册与发现
  2. 资源调度层:集成Anycast路由算法实现全球流量智能分发
  3. 安全防护层:构建DNSSEC+DDoS防护的立体化防御体系
  4. 数据管理层:支持海量解析日志的实时分析与异常检测
  5. 设备连接层:提供IoT设备的零信任接入认证机制
  6. 内网解析层:实现混合云环境下的私有域名解析服务

某头部云服务商的测试数据显示,采用新一代DNS架构后,微服务架构下的服务发现时延从120ms降至35ms,DDoS攻击拦截率提升至99.97%。

二、韧性DNS的三大技术支柱

1. 智能调度引擎:动态流量管理的核心

现代DNS系统需构建基于机器学习的流量预测模型,通过历史查询数据训练出时序预测算法。典型实现方案包含三个模块:

  1. class TrafficPredictor:
  2. def __init__(self, window_size=3600):
  3. self.model = LSTM(input_shape=(window_size, 5)) # 5维特征:QPS/地域/协议类型等
  4. self.scaler = MinMaxScaler()
  5. def train(self, historical_data):
  6. normalized = self.scaler.fit_transform(historical_data)
  7. # 模型训练逻辑...
  8. def predict(self, current_metrics):
  9. normalized = self.scaler.transform([current_metrics])
  10. return self.model.predict(normalized)

调度引擎需集成多种路由策略:

  • 地理感知路由:基于IP定位数据库实现就近接入
  • 健康检查路由:实时监测节点状态自动剔除故障实例
  • 成本优化路由:结合带宽价格动态调整流量路径

2. 安全防护体系:构建纵深防御机制

AI时代的DNS安全面临三大威胁向量:

  • 缓存投毒攻击:通过伪造响应篡改解析结果
  • 放大反射攻击:利用DNS协议特性实施DDoS
  • 数据泄露风险:解析日志中的敏感信息暴露

防护方案需采用分层设计:

  1. 传输层安全:强制启用DNS-over-HTTPS(DoH)协议
  2. 认证机制:部署DNSSEC验证链确保响应完整性
  3. 行为分析:建立用户查询行为基线模型,实时检测异常
  4. 流量清洗:集成智能流量 scrubbing 中心,自动识别攻击特征

某安全团队实测表明,采用AI驱动的异常检测系统后,未知威胁识别率提升60%,误报率降低至0.3%以下。

3. 弹性架构设计:支撑海量并发请求

现代DNS系统需具备百万级QPS处理能力,架构设计需关注:

  • 无状态化设计:解析节点不保存会话状态,便于横向扩展
  • 多级缓存架构:构建L1(本地)/L2(区域)/L3(全局)三级缓存
  • 异步处理机制:将日志记录、监控告警等非核心流程异步化

典型部署方案采用混合云架构:

  1. [用户终端] [智能DNS网关] [全球Anycast节点]
  2. [日志分析集群] [监控告警系统] [核心解析集群]

该架构在某电商平台618大促中支撑了峰值420万QPS,平均解析时延稳定在8ms以内。

三、实施路径与最佳实践

1. 渐进式迁移策略

建议采用三阶段实施路线:

  1. 基础加固期(0-6个月):完成DNSSEC部署和监控体系建设
  2. 能力扩展期(6-12个月):引入智能调度和安全分析模块
  3. 生态整合期(12-18个月):实现与CDN、边缘计算等系统的深度集成

2. 关键指标监控体系

需建立四大类监控指标:

  • 可用性指标:解析成功率、故障恢复时间
  • 性能指标:平均解析时延、缓存命中率
  • 安全指标:攻击拦截次数、异常查询比例
  • 业务指标:服务发现效率、资源利用率

3. 灾备方案设计

推荐采用”3-2-1”灾备原则:

  • 保留3份数据副本(生产+同城+异地)
  • 使用2种存储介质(SSD+对象存储)
  • 部署1套离线备份系统

某金融机构的实践显示,该方案使DNS系统RTO缩短至15秒以内,RPO接近零。

四、未来演进方向

随着AI技术的深入发展,DNS系统将呈现三大趋势:

  1. 意图驱动解析:通过自然语言处理理解用户查询意图
  2. 区块链集成:利用分布式账本技术增强解析可信度
  3. 量子安全防护:提前布局抗量子计算的加密算法

在AI重构互联网基础设施的关键时期,构建韧性DNS系统已成为企业数字化转型的必选项。通过智能调度、安全防护、弹性架构的协同创新,DNS正从传统的网络目录服务进化为智能流量管理中枢,为万物互联时代提供关键基础设施支撑。技术团队需把握窗口期,通过体系化建设赢得AI时代的网络竞争力。